About Grantham Town

Grantham Town Football Club, fondly known as "The Gingerbreads," is a semi-professional football club based in Grantham, Lincolnshire, England. The club was established in 1874, making it one of the oldest football clubs in the country. Throughout its history, Grantham Town has been a significant part of the local community, providing a platform for local talent to showcase their skills and fostering a sense of unity among its supporters.

The club's home ground is The South Kesteven Sports Stadium, also known as The Meres, which has a capacity of around 7,500 spectators. The stadium has been their home since 1991, after moving from their previous ground, London Road. The Gingerbreads' traditional colours are black and white, which are reflected in their distinctive striped home kit.

Grantham Town has spent the majority of its history in the non-league system of English football. The club has competed in various leagues, including the Central Alliance, the Midland League, and the Northern Premier League. The Gingerbreads' most notable achievement came in the 1973-74 season when they reached the third round of the FA Cup, eventually losing to Middlesbrough.

In terms of league success, Grantham Town's most significant accomplishment was winning the Northern Premier League Premier Division in the 1986-87 season. This victory marked the club's highest ever league finish and remains a proud moment in their history.

Over the years, Grantham Town has nurtured several players who went on to have successful professional careers. The most famous of these is probably Martin O'Neill, who played for the club in the early 1970s before going on to achieve great success with Nottingham Forest and later as a manager at several top-flight clubs.

Despite facing financial difficulties and relegation battles in the past, Grantham Town has always bounced back, demonstrating the resilience and determination that embody the spirit of the club. The Gingerbreads' loyal fan base has been instrumental in this, providing unwavering support through thick and thin.

Today, Grantham Town continues to compete in the Northern Premier League Premier Division, striving to climb the ranks of English football. The club remains deeply rooted in the local community, with a dedicated team of volunteers helping to ensure its smooth operation.
